Etymology[edit]
encyclopedia + -an
Adjective[edit]
encyclopedian (not comparable)
- Encyclopedic; embracing the whole circle of learning, or a wide range of subjects.
Synonyms[edit]
- encyclopediac
- encyclopediacal (archaic)
- encyclopedial (rare)
- encyclopedic
- encyclopedical
Noun[edit]
encyclopedian (plural encyclopedians)
- A person who has an encyclopedic knowledge.
